I have a round face and for years thought that blush wasn’t for me (wouldn’t want to risk looking even more round, right?). Well, I’m shedding some of those myths now and learning to embrace my face (and my body) and use things I want to use, not just the ones I’m supposedly allowed to use.


I find cream colors easier to apply and less intimidating than powders. Canmake Cream Cheek is a gel-type color that melts on the skin for a radiant glow. These come in 14 colors (mine is CL05 Clear Happiness) and are available on YesStyle (reward code KBHOBBIT) and Amazon.

How to use

  • Apply with fingers to the desired areas

  • Gently blend

  • Can be layered for a more intense color


The gel can be applied on top of powder or liquid foundation and sets to a non-sticky finish. You can see me use it in this video.

My impressions

I’m still timid when it comes to makeup, so I stick with one layer for a very natural look. I love it, especially after using bb cream which tends to wash me out slightly. This is the easiest blush I’ve ever used, and it’s also conveniently portable. Canmake is quickly becoming a favorite of mine when it comes to makeup, especially their marshmallow powder (review here). I highly recommend them if you want to try some Japanese brands.

Canmake Cream Cheek ingredients: Isotridecyl isononanoate, squalane, dimethicone, dextrin palmitate, methylmethicicate crosspolymer, polyglyceryl-2 triisostearate-2, (vinyldimethicone / methiconesil sesquioxane) crosspolymer, sorbitan sesquiisostearate, (dimethicone / vinyldimethicone) cloth Polymer, Didimethylsilylated Silica, Tocopherol, Di (phytosteryl / octyldodecyl) lauroyl glutamate, Hydrogen dimethicone, Dimethicone borosilicate (Ca / Al), Tarku, Yellow 4, Titanium oxide, Mica, Silica, Red 201, Iron oxide, Red 202 , Ba sulfate, Al hydroxide
